Definitely a scam. Typically, what happens is he will ask for your bank account number and/or other personal information. Instead of depositing money in your account he withdraws it from your account. Another angle is that he will ask for money inorder to process the paper work. You send the money and you'll never here from him. Anyway, it won't hurt to give him a call or e-mail him. Be very careful!

Beware of anything from Lagos, Nigeria and overseas. The big ones are you won a lottery, Some uncle died in a plane crash, anything to do with oil and oil drilling, My relative died and I have millions of dollars that I can't get so I need your help. This must be kept confidential TOTAL SCAMS
They will ask you for a bank account were they can deposit the money, then the bleeding begins and once they get you on the hook they will suck you out of thousands of dollars. This happened to one of my freinds and all the papers looked legit even right down to the bank of nigeria, like I told my freind walkaway!!! |
